Harmony Mental Health, Inc. is a private non-profit 501(c) 3 that is committed to supporting providers offering services to West Virginia’s children and families. With offices in Jackson, Kanawha, Wood, Wirt, Tyler, and Wetzel Counties Harmony Mental Health offers practice management, grant writing and other support services. Direct services are provided via Harmony Family Services and Harmony Health Services.

Fun Fact: Before becoming a federal holiday, Labor Day was recognized by labor activists and individual states. Although it isn't entirely clear who proposed the holiday for workers, some accounts back the claim of two workers being the founders of Labor Day: 1. Peter J. McGuire: A carpenter and co-founder of the American Federation of Labor, who in 1882 suggested setting aside a day for laboring classes "who from rude nature have delved and carved all the grandeur we behold." 2. Matthew Maguire: A machinist who, according to the New Jersey Historical Society, was credited by the Paterson Morning Call as "the undisputed author of Labor Day as a holiday" after President Cleveland signed it into law. Both Maguire and McGuire are known to have attended the country's first-ever Labor Day parade in New York City. Labor Day officially became recognized as a federal holiday in the United States in 1894.
